管理人の一言
やっほー!国内のAI狂いこと、ブログ管理人の美少女アバターだよ!今日は2026年4月27日、エンジニア界隈が「EvanFlow」の登場で大騒ぎになってるから急いで記事にまとめちゃった!みんな、TDD(テスト駆動開発)って知ってるかな?
「まずテストを書いて、それをパスするようにコードを書く」っていう、バグを減らすための最強の手法なんだけど……正直、自分で回すのって結構大変だったんだよね。でも、Anthropicの「ClaudeCode」を自動操縦するEvanFlowの登場で、その常識がガラッと変わろうとしてるんだ!
これ、何がすごいかっていうと、人間が「こんな機能が欲しい」ってテストを書くだけで、あとはAIが勝手に「テスト失敗→修正→再実行」のループを回して、ゴール(合格)まで走り抜けてくれるの。まさに「AIによるデバッグの反復横跳び」の自動化だね!
Gemini-3-flash-previewちゃんみたいな最新AIを使えば、Pythonの複雑なライブラリ構成だって一瞬で理解してくれちゃう時代が来たんだよ。それじゃあ、スレの様子を覗いてみよう!
3行でわかる!今回の話題
- ClaudeCodeのフィードバックループをTDD(テスト駆動開発)で自動化する新ツール「EvanFlow」が登場。
- テストが通るまでAIが自己修正を繰り返すことで、開発者の「デバッグの反復横跳び」を丸投げ可能に。
- AIが迷走する「Dumbzone(おバカ地帯)」の回避や、プログラマーの役割が「仕様の定義」へ移行する点について議論が紛糾。
EvanFlow – A TDD driven feedback loop for Claude Code
https://github.com/evanklem/evanflow
A TDD-driven iterative feedback loop for software development. 16 cohesive Claude Code skills walk an idea from brainstorm → plan → execute → tdd → iterate, with checkpoints throughout. – evanklem/evanflow
テスト書いて、Claudeにコード書かせて、パスするまで自動でリトライ。
これマジで開発の概念変わるわ。
[1]EvanFlow–ATDDdrivenfeedbackloopforClaudeCode
「EvanFlow-thoughtsarrivelikebutterflies?」
タイトルにPearlJamの歌詞混ぜてくるあたり、作者の世代がバレるなwww
思考が蝶のように舞い降りる(笑)ポエムかよ。
【thoughtsarrivelikebutterflies】
90年代を代表するロックバンド、パール・ジャム(PearlJam)のヒット曲『EvenFlow』の歌詞の一節だよ。ツール名の「EvanFlow」がこの曲名にかけているから、海外や古参のエンジニアが歌詞を引用して盛り上がっているんだね。AIエージェントって一度沼ると、同じ間違いを延々と繰り返してトークン溶かすよな。
そこらへんの対策が気になるわ。
【Dumbzone(おバカ地帯)】
AIエージェントが同じ間違いをループしたり、修正すればするほど状況が悪化したりする「迷子状態」を指すスラングだね。トークン(利用料)だけが溶けていく、エンジニアにとっての恐怖の現象だよ。「Oh,hedon’tknow,sohechasesthemaway(あいつは何も分かっちゃいない)」
とかレスしようと思ったら、もう歌詞の続き書かれてたわ。
開発スレなのにノリが良すぎるだろwww
これ実際使ってみたけど、ClaudeCode単体で使うより圧倒的に「詰み」が減るわ。
テストっていう明確なゴールがあるから、AIが迷子にならない。
・まず開発者がテストコードを書くか、Claudeにテスト仕様を投げさせる。
・EvanFlowがテストを実行し、失敗(Red)を確認する。
・ClaudeCodeがそのテストを通すためだけに実装コードを書く。
・テストがパス(Green)するまで、EvanFlowがエラーログをClaudeに食わせ続けてループを回す。
・最後にリファクタリングを指示して完了。
要するに、人間がやってた「デバッグの反復横跳び」を全部AIに丸投げできるってことだな。
Dumbzone回避については、最近のGemini-3-flash-previewとかClaudeの最新版なら、
コンテキストの使い方が上手いから、過去の失敗履歴を「反省」としてプロンプトに自動注入すればいけるはず。
EvanFlowがそのへんのステート管理をどこまでやってるかが鍵だな。
「テスト仕様をAIに正確に伝える仕事」になるな。
結局、仕様が書けない奴はAI時代でも淘汰されるってわけか……。
環境構築で沼ったらまた来るわwww
管理人のまとめ
今回のEvanFlowの登場、みんなはどう感じたかな?私はね、これが「プログラミング」という行為そのものの定義を書き換える、決定的な分岐点になると思っているよ!これまでのAI開発支援は、あくまで「人間が書くのを手伝う」コパイロット形式が主流だったよね。
でもEvanFlowが提示したのは、AIを「自律的なエージェント」としてTDDのサイクル(Red-Green-Refactor)に完全に組み込む手法なんだ。スレでも言及されていた「Dumbzone(おバカ地帯)」、つまり同じ間違いを繰り返してトークンを溶かす現象も、Gemini-3-flash-previewのような最新モデルが持つ「過去の試行錯誤をコンテキストに含めて反省する能力」があれば、もはや過去の悩みになりつつあるよ。
特にPythonは構文が明快でテストフレームワークも充実しているから、AIにとって最も「成功体験を積みやすい」言語なんだよね。愛しのPythonと最強のGeminiが組み合わされば、もはや人間が1行も実装コードを書かずに、大規模なバックエンドシステムが組み上がる未来もすぐそこだよ!
ただ、楽観視ばかりもしていられないんだ。スレの9番さんが言った通り、これからのプログラマーに求められるのは「アルゴリズムを書く能力」ではなく、「厳密で隙のないテスト仕様(=プロンプトとしての仕様書)を定義する能力」へと完全にシフトする。
仕様が曖昧だと、AIは「テストさえ通ればいい」という歪んだ最適化をして、メンテナンス不能なスパゲッティコードを生み出すリスクもあるからね。私たちは今、コードの「書き手」から、AIという「最強の執行人」を導く「設計者」への脱皮を迫られているんだよ。
でも安心して!Geminiと一緒にPythonを学んできたみんななら、この変化を最高に楽しめるはず。だって、面倒なデバッグは全部AIに任せて、私たちはもっとクリエイティブな構想に時間を割けるようになるんだから!
これこそが、AI狂いの私たちが夢見た世界だよね!






